House at Kennett River

This deliberately modest dwelling provides the essentials for a beachside getaway. Its simple skillion form recalls the coastal structures of the 50’s and sits comfortably within this small town on Victoria’s Great Ocean Road. Clad in corrugated steel it is ideally orientated to obtain winter sun, summer shade and all year views of the adjacent bush. An intimate interior is crafted from the use of timber panels to the floor, walls and ceiling as well as cabinetry and sliding panels. The house demonstrates how rigorous planning can achieve a cost effective yet spacious outcome for a family retreat.
